We have a series of data tables (listing various countries down the left, and several columns of criteria across the top) that we have created for a research website we are building. The tables have developed in Adobe InDesign CS3, and the font used is Helvetica Condensed (as there is alot of text to fit into these tables). We then exported the tables from InDesign as EPS files, opened the EPS files in Illustrator CS3, and exported them as .PNG files at 72 dpi, and placed in a CMS (Sitefinity). We established 3 different pixel widths for these tables, and are ensuring they are being imported at 100%. The problem is that we are disappointed in the quality of the text on screen. It's quite blurry. We are now looking at going back and redoing the tables using the Verdana font and making the text a little larger, but before doing that, I wanted to check if there are other avenues we should be exploring first.
